@@ -41,10 +59,14 @@ If you're using a USB adapter and have a driver kext matched to it,
|
||||
you will need to unload it prior to running OpenOCD. E.g. with Apple
|
||||
driver (OS X 10.9 or later) for FTDI run:
|
||||
|
||||
```sh
|
||||
sudo kextunload -b com.apple.driver.AppleUSBFTDI
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
for FTDI vendor driver use:
|
||||
|
||||
```sh
|
||||
sudo kextunload FTDIUSBSerialDriver.kext
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
To learn more on the topic please refer to the official libusb FAQ: <https://github.com/libusb/libusb/wiki/FAQ>
